微信小程序增删改查实战教程:实例与代码详解

7 下载量 76 浏览量 更新于2024-09-01 4 收藏 162KB PDF 举报
在微信小程序开发中,实现数据的基本增删改查操作是非常关键的环节,本文将详细介绍如何在微信小程序中通过实例来操作收货地址的管理功能。首先,让我们从以下几个步骤来理解这个过程: 1. **数据结构与界面设计**: - 在一个典型的项目中,这些操作通常在前端界面与后端API之间交互。前端界面通常由.wxml文件构建,类似于HTML,负责显示用户界面,如上面提供的代码展示了收货地址信息的表单部分,包括姓名、电话、地址和送货时间的选择器。这部分代码利用了`<formbindsubmit>`事件处理函数`addSubmit`,当用户提交表单时触发。 2. **逻辑控制与接口调用**: - `1.js`文件是业务逻辑的核心,负责发送网络请求并处理数据。在这里,它充当客户端与服务器之间的桥梁,例如,当用户输入信息并点击保存(提交)按钮时,会调用后端接口执行增删改查操作。这部分可能涉及到`wx.request`或`axios`等库来实现网络请求。 3. **数据存储与配置**: - `.json`文件(如`2.json`)用于页面局部配置,它可以覆盖全局的`app.json`配置,确保每个页面的数据管理和样式独立。在这里,可能包含特定于收货地址页的配置,如API地址、请求头等。 4. **样式定制**: - `.wxss`文件用于定义页面的样式,包括布局、颜色、字体等,确保界面美观且易用。对于收货地址表单,这部分可能涉及输入框、文本和选择器的样式设置。 5. **增删改查操作**: - 实现具体的操作(增、删、改、查)一般包括以下步骤: - **添加(增)**:收集用户输入的收货信息,通过`wx.request`发送POST请求到后端,创建新的收货地址。 - **删除(删)**:根据用户选择或指定的ID,发送DELETE请求删除对应的收货地址。 - **修改(改)**:在用户编辑后,更新表单中的数据,然后发送PUT请求更新已存在的地址信息。 - **查询(查)**:通过GET请求获取所有收货地址,或者根据条件筛选特定地址,展示在列表或详细视图中。 通过以上步骤,开发者能够熟练掌握微信小程序中数据管理的基本操作,无论是对新手还是进阶者,这都是构建实用小程序的重要基础。实际开发过程中,还应关注错误处理、数据验证和用户体验优化等问题。